Output fb592c66007ba74c1ac059e3f76d83c8484aeb4eafa5bdc6ebdc674101bb47fe:1

value
1772073
script pubkey
OP_0 OP_PUSHBYTES_20 d8af80a77575dc2ed23b553217025e3d635ebb13
address
bc1qmzhcpfm4whwza53m25epwqj78434awcngrk7m0
transaction
fb592c66007ba74c1ac059e3f76d83c8484aeb4eafa5bdc6ebdc674101bb47fe
confirmations
148563
spent
true